Find out about Testing, Signing and Technical Support

Application testing is a required component of the development process. Every application offered through Nokia sales channels must have Java Verified™ or Symbian Signed certification guaranteeing its integrity. This section provides directions and helpful guidelines to minimise time-to-market through fast, efficient, and easy application testing.

You will also find information about Forum Nokia Technical Support, which offers technical expertise to mobile developers during the application development process. Technical support can be used to solve a specific problem or answer a focused technical question, on a case-by-case basis.

Go to Market

Let’s suppose you’ve just completed development on a new application that will forever change the way people use their mobile devices. Now what? Are you prepared to market and sell your product to consumers around the world?

The new publishing to Ovi tool enables third-party application and content developers to easily access a single Nokia channel — the Ovi Store — that can reach many millions of consumers. This channel will create instant revenue opportunities: Developers who use the publishing to Ovi tool will receive a 70 per cent revenue share from their applications and content that are distributed through the Ovi Store. The store will offer consumers applications, games, personalisation content, and more.
